Здравствуйте, гость ( Вход | Регистрация )

 
Ответить в эту темуОткрыть новую тему
> lineage 2 респ рб, lineage 2 респ рб
seny
сообщение 18.4.2018, 10:19
Сообщение #1


*

Registred
Сообщений: 1
Регистрация: 18.4.2018
Группа: Пользователи
Наличность: 0
Пользователь №: 18.907
Возраст: 29



Всем здрасте.
Есть ли возможность написать скрипт скажем палилка рб по изменению цвета в данном месте,
ну как бы запомнить цвета где нет РБ а когда он ресается срабатывает звуковое оповещение.
Если кто знает иные варианты подскажите пожалуйста.


Заранее огромное спасибо
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
cirus
сообщение 18.4.2018, 11:01
Сообщение #2


**********

Elder
Сообщений: 3.480
Регистрация: 18.8.2014
Группа: Пользователи
Наличность: 26540
Пользователь №: 16.971
Возраст: 29



Код
// сделать привязку Ctrl+A
send f1         // нажать f1, макрос с таргетом рб
wait 1000       // ждём 1 секунду
if 204, 15 3678643  // проверяем цвет, хп рб
    alarm           // звуковой сигнал
    end_script
end_if
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
DarkMaster
сообщение 20.4.2018, 20:26
Сообщение #3


***********

Модератор UOPilot
Сообщений: 9.460
Регистрация: 2.12.2008
Группа: Супермодераторы
Наличность: 27708
Пользователь №: 11.279



Там можно как-то внутренним макросом сделать. Склероз уже немножко, но суть в том, что проверка по цвету не нужна впринципе. Там делается таргет, после чего пишется в личку ник тегированный типа %target или как он там кодируется. Не помню уже. Суть в том, что пустое/невалидное сообщение не отправится, а как только появится рб, соответственно и таргет, то сообщение начнет отсылаться.


--------------------
Скрипты UOPilot под заказ.
Консультации по UOpilot 15$/час.
Услуги Lua разработчика (не пилот, проекты, постоянка)
Disсоrd:
Kov____
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
genocide
сообщение 1.5.2018, 15:18
Сообщение #4


***

Novice
Сообщений: 79
Регистрация: 2.2.2013
Группа: Пользователи
Наличность: 0
Пользователь №: 15.752
Возраст: 21



Хз как сделать так как говорит Дарк, может как-то через общую блокировку чата...
/allblock Включить режим тишины. Отключение чата.
/allunblock Выключить режим тишины
А ПМ чат бота делают так. "%target Привет %tatget - нет таргета нет сообщения, но это не то..))
Мой такой скрипт работал от ХП и присылал СМС через браузер с заранее введенной капчей.
Сейчас думаю лучше делать всё автоматически - это ж пилот пусть пилотирует xD
Код

// сделать привязку Ctrl+A
send f1                            // нажать f1, макрос с таргетом рб
wait 1000                          // ждём 1 секунду
if  204, 15 3678643                // проверяем цвет, хп рб
    while 204, 15 3678643          // Ждем когда завалят рб
    wait 1000
    end_while
set #kill 1
end_if

if #kill = 1        //если рб был убит ищем сундук и подходим к нему
    send f2         //таргет на сундук
    send f2
    set #bluetext findcolor (0 0 1024 768 1 1 (9794906) %bluetext 2) Ищем кликабельный синий текст по всему экрану, что бы поговорить с сундуком.
        if  #bluetext > 0
        kleft   %bluetext [1 1] %bluetext [1 2]    //говорим с сундуком
        end_if
end_if

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
DarkMaster
сообщение 2.5.2018, 15:25
Сообщение #5


***********

Модератор UOPilot
Сообщений: 9.460
Регистрация: 2.12.2008
Группа: Супермодераторы
Наличность: 27708
Пользователь №: 11.279



Цитата
Хз как сделать так как говорит Дарк, может как-то через общую блокировку чата...
/allblock Включить режим тишины. Отключение чата.
/allunblock Выключить режим тишины
А ПМ чат бота делают так. "%target Привет %tatget - нет таргета нет сообщения, но это не то..))

Ну так так и делать. Убираем таргет. В макросе в игре пишем:
/target boss_name
# %target is alive
как-то так напишет в пати чат. Я просто не помню уже точный синтаксис. Этого макроса достаточно.

Буду благодарен, если кто-то напишет точный синтаксис макроса на взятие цели и написание в пм/канал.


--------------------
Скрипты UOPilot под заказ.
Консультации по UOpilot 15$/час.
Услуги Lua разработчика (не пилот, проекты, постоянка)
Disсоrd:
Kov____
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ения
cirus
сообщение 2.5.2018, 16:14
Сообщение #6


**********

Elder
Сообщений: 3.480
Регистрация: 18.8.2014
Группа: Пользователи
Наличность: 26540
Пользователь №: 16.971
Возраст: 29



Цитата
точный синтаксис макроса на взятие цели и написание в пм/канал.

Так и есть. Главное пробел не забыть между # и %.
В пати чат:
Цитата
/target boss_name
# %target is alive

В пм:
Код
/target boss_name
"ник_перса %target is alive

Пользователь в офлайнеDelete PostОтправить личное сообщение
Вернуться в начало страницы
+Ответить с цитированием данного сообщения

Ответить в эту темуОткрыть новую тему
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 

- Текстовая версия | Версия для КПК Сейчас: 28.3.2024, 21:59
Designed by Nickostyle